Coronavirus: Archbishop asks Govt to take swift measures

Archbishop of Colombo Malcolm Cardinal Ranjith and Venerable Ittapane Dhammalankara Thera held a media briefing today (28) on the coronavirus that has now been confirmed in Sri Lanka. 

Cardinal Ranjith told the media briefing that it was important to look into the safety of children especially since schools are a place where the virus can spread rapidly. He urged education authorities to look into this issue. 

He further asked the Government to take all necessary steps to control the situation and said they are willing to support these efforts. He noted that there was currently a shortage of surgical masks and asked the Government to ensure that sufficient stocks are brought into the country. The Archbishop further asked people not to panic over the matter.  

He also said the Catholic Church was prepared to close down schools that comes under it if there was an epidemic.
